Fly from Tallinn to Madeira 

 

airBaltic will launch direct flights between Tallinn and Madeira in October. The new route will operate every Sunday from 26 October 2025 to 22 March 2026. Tickets are already on sale on the company’s official website. One-way fares start at €180.

“We are delighted to add direct flights from Tallinn to Madeira to our flight network. The island is often called Europe’s Hawaii due to its volcanic landscapes, lush forests, and endless sea views. Madeira offers something completely different from a typical Mediterranean holiday,” says Mantas Vrubliauskas, Deputy Director of Network Management at airBaltic.

 

Amsterdam–Tallinn flights have become more popular—connections to Dubai via Riga

The Amsterdam route has become increasingly popular both among leisure and business travelers. Due to the increased demand, airBaltic is doubling flights to the Dutch capital.

The Dubai connection is also of interest. If you are attracted by the exoticism of Arabic culture and modern luxury, you can fly from Tallinn to Dubai daily via Riga. The price of a one-way ticket is around €215.
